Job Description
Empowered Staffing is proud to partner with a dynamic real estate investment firm specializing in multi-family apartment communities across high-growth markets in the United States. Since its inception in 2008, the firm has evolved its focus to encompass large-scale apartment communities, land development, and strategic expansion into the industrial and self-storage sectors. With a commitment to growth capital investment expertise, the firm consistently explores new opportunities and nurtures partnerships to drive ongoing success.
Currently, the firm is seeking a motivated and results-driven individual with a passion for real estate to join their team as a Real Estate Analyst/Project Manager and play a pivotal role in supporting the company’s executive team, conducting in-depth financial analysis, and providing valuable insights to support the firm's continued success.
Responsibilities:
Utilize strong forecasting, budgeting, and financial modeling skills to ensure accurate cash and capital tracking.
Prepare comprehensive financial reports, conduct market analysis, evaluate acquisitions, and create predictive models and budgeting strategies.
Demonstrate meticulous attention to detail in a fast-paced environment, ensuring the precision of all financial analyses and project assessments.
Undertake special projects and analyses for the firm’s Principal, contributing to informed decision-making at the highest level.
Comfortably engage in travel up to 2 times per month, balancing on-site project oversight with office-based responsibilities.
Collaborate effectively with executives, showcasing confidence in speaking, pitching, and presenting to partner-level individuals.
Requirements:
Bachelor's degree in Finance, Real Estate, or a related field preferred
Proven time management skills to successfully oversee multiple projects simultaneously.
Advanced Microsoft Excel skills encompass building, modeling, waterfall analysis, and reporting.
Proficiency in relevant software, including Argus Enterprise, RealPage Asset Monitoring, and Microsoft Office.
1-5 years of experience in Real Estate Finance, with a focus on multi-family, Class A, retail, commercial, or industrial properties.
Demonstrated ability to work independently, showcasing reliability and organizational prowess.
Professional, energetic, and positive demeanor, with superb customer service skills.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ively convey complex information to various stakeholders.
